In cooperation with the Chair of Laser Technology LLT, the Fraunhofer Institute for Laser Technology ILT, Europe's leading center for contract research and development in the field of laser technology, offers the opportunity to write a thesis.

In the Thin Film Processing group, we develop processes for the laser functionalization of thin films. In doing so, we optimize material properties such as conductivity, adhesion, and tightness using processes such as sintering, crystallization, and melting. One focus of our research is printed electronics, where we manufacture the layers ourselves using digital printing processes. We are currently working on the additive manufacturing of printed sensors (contactless, digital, and targeted application of thin films to substrates).
